Abstract: Methods, systems, and devices for wireless communications are described. A user equipment (UE) may receive control signaling from a network entity scheduling a set of multiple periodic tracking reference signals (TRSs) and indicating a transmission power level for the periodic TRSs. For example, the control signaling may be received via radio resource control (RRC). The UE may receive a downlink control information (DCI) message from the network entity indicating an adjustment to the transmission power level and a resource for an aperiodic TRS. The UE may monitor the resource for the aperiodic TRS in accordance with the indicated adjustment to the transmission power level. The UE may transmit a message to the network entity indicating a measurement of the aperiodic TRS based on the adjustment to the power level. The adjustment to the power level may apply to one or more of the set of multiple periodic TRSs.

Abstract: Methods, systems, and devices for wireless communications are described. In some examples, a user equipment (UE) may receive control signaling indicating a configuration for performing channel sensing. The configuration may include one or more parameters corresponding to a processing time associated with the channel sensing. The UE may adjust the processing time associated with the channel sensing based on the one or more parameters and a full duplex capability of the first UE. The UE may transmit, using a first set of resources, a sidelink message based on the adjusted processing time. In some examples, the UE may transmit a first data message associated with a first priority level and perform channel sensing for a second data message associated with a second priority level that is higher than the first priority level. The UE may drop the first data message, skip an interference cancellation, or a combination thereof.

Abstract: Methods, systems, and devices for wireless communications are described. A user equipment (UE) may transmit an indication of a capability associated with maintaining phase continuity and power consistency for demodulation reference signal (DMRS) bundling between a full-duplex slot and a half-duplex slot. The UE may transmit a first signal during a first slot of a first time domain window (TDW) associated with the DMRS bundling. The UE may determine whether to terminate the first TDW based on the capability associated with maintaining the phase continuity and the power consistency between the full-duplex slot and the half-duplex slot. The UE may transmit a second signal during a second slot of the first TDW or a second TDW based on the determination of whether to terminate the first TDW.

Abstract: Aspects of the disclosure relate to obtaining a duplex mode of a scheduled entity, selecting a downlink-uplink (DU) slot interpretation to be applied by the scheduled entity to a slot including a DU symbol based on the duplex mode of the scheduled entity, and transmitting the DU slot interpretation to the scheduled entity. The DU symbol may be configured to include a downlink transmission and an uplink transmission within a same carrier bandwidth. Other aspects relate to receiving a message, indicating that the slot is formatted with a DU symbol, selecting a DU slot interpretation to be applied to the slot including the DU symbol based on a duplex mode of the scheduled entity, and applying the DU slot interpretation to the slot. Abstract: A user equipment may be configured to implement a procedure for combining half-duplex and full-duplex channel state information (CSI) into a single report. In some aspects, the user equipment may receive uplink control information configuration information including one or more parameters for multiplexing half-duplex (HD) channel state information (CSI) and full-duplex (FD) CSI as a combined CSI report, and receive a first reference signal associated with a HD mode and a second reference signal associated with a FD mode. Further, the user equipment may transmit, to a base station, the combined CSI report based on the one or more parameters, the first reference signal, and the second reference signal.

Abstract: Methods, systems, and devices for wireless communications are described. Generally, a base station may dynamically and reliably indicate that pending transmissions are part of a full duplex operation via downlink control information (DCI) designs described herein. For example, a base station may transmit, to a user equipment (UE) a DCI including no more than one downlink grant and no more than one uplink grant for a full duplex operation. In some examples, the base station may transmit a first-stage DCI including partial information, and second-stage DCIs including full uplink and downlink grants for a full duplex operation. In some examples, the base station may configure periodic or semi-periodic uplink and downlink resources that may overlap in time, and may dynamically indicate, to the UE, whether the overlapping uplink and downlink resources are scheduled for a full duplex operation.

Abstract: Methods, systems, and devices for wireless communications are described. A user equipment (UE) may receive a control message from a base station indicating a configuration of an uplink waveform for full-duplex communications at the UE. The UE may receive an additional control message scheduling a set of uplink resources and a set of downlink resources for the full-duplex communications. The set of uplink resources and the set of downlink resources may at least partially overlap in a time-domain. A frequency-domain gap between the set of uplink resources and the set of downlink resources may be based on the first uplink waveform and a first downlink waveform used by the base station. The UE may communicate with the base station on the set of uplink resources and the set of downlink resources in accordance with the frequency-domain gap.

Abstract: Methods, systems, and devices for wireless communications are described. A base station may identify that the base station is going to enter a communication state associated with a capability limitation where the base station does not support at least one communications application while operating in the communication state. The communication state may be a power saving mode. The base station may transmit a message to a user equipment (UE) indicating the capability limitation(s) associated with the communication state, and communicate with the UE according to the capability limitation(s). The base station may identify that the base station has scheduled communications with a UE in accordance with an SPS configuration or a configured grant. The base station may transmit a message to the UE indicating an update for the SPS configuration or the configured grant based on a capability limitation associated with the communication state.

Abstract: Methods, systems, and devices for wireless communications are described. For example, a method for wireless communications at a wireless device may include determining a rate matching configuration for a first channel (e.g., an uplink channel) associated with a second channel (e.g., a downlink channel). A wireless device may determine rate matching resources of an uplink channel based on the rate matching configuration. The wireless device may determine rate matching resources of a downlink channel based on the rate matching configuration. The wireless device may transmit a first message on the uplink channel or the downlink channel, respectively, where the transmitted channel includes the rate matching resources. The wireless device may receive a reference signal on one or more resources of the downlink channel or the uplink channel, respectively, where the one or more resources of the respective channel correspond to the rate matching resources on the transmitted channel.
